笨小猴题型答案😀
#include <bits/stdc++.h>
using namespace std;
bool zs(int x)
{
if(x==1||x==0) return false;
for(int i=2;i<=sqrt(x);i++)
{
if(x%i==0) return false;
}
return true;
}
int a[26];
int main()
{
char ch[100000];
int max=0,min=9999;
getchar();
gets(ch);
int len=strlen(ch);
for(int i=0;i<len;i++)
{
a[ch[i]-a]=a[ch[i]-a]+1;
}
for(int i=0;i<26;i++)
{
if(a[i]>max) max=a[i];
if(a[i]<min&&a[i]!=0) min=a[i];
}
if(zs(max-min))
{
cout<<"Lucky Word"<<endl;
cout<<max-min<<endl;
}
else
{
cout<<"No Answer"<<endl;
cout<<max-min<<endl;
}
return 0;
}
#include <bits/stdc++.h>
using namespace std;
bool zs(int x)
{
if(x==1||x==0) return false;
for(int i=2;i<=sqrt(x);i++)
{
if(x%i==0) return false;
}
return true;
}
int a[26];
int main()
{
char ch[100000];
int max=0,min=9999;
getchar();
gets(ch);
int len=strlen(ch);
for(int i=0;i<len;i++)
{
a[ch[i]-a]=a[ch[i]-a]+1;
}
for(int i=0;i<26;i++)
{
if(a[i]>max) max=a[i];
if(a[i]<min&&a[i]!=0) min=a[i];
}
if(zs(max-min))
{
cout<<"Lucky Word"<<endl;
cout<<max-min<<endl;
}
else
{
cout<<"No Answer"<<endl;
cout<<max-min<<endl;
}
return 0;
}
2020-10-15
在牛客打卡4天,今天学习:刷题 5 道
全部评论
相关推荐
01-23 13:06
西华大学 Web前端
白火同学:你可以把自我评价和教育背景互掉个顺序,学校算是HR比较看重的title之一了,除非特别差,否则没必要放最后面。
三个项目有点多,那第二个项目和第三个项目有重叠内容,那你可以把项目融合一下,扩展一下业务面。 点赞 评论 收藏
分享
OPPO公司福利 1091人发布